Right-click on a .wba file, go to Open With... then 'Choose default program'. Browse to the WindowBlinds directory, and select wbload.exe. That should do the trick.

Wow, that was probably the easiest reproduction of a problem I've managed. 1. Quit OD+ with a tabbed dock on the primary. 2. Start OD+ then quickly move mouse to secondary. 3. Watch as tabbed dock from primary appears on secondary. Vista, latest beta of OD+
